To facilitate foreign investment into the country a number of steps have been taken by Government of India in the past. Setting up an Authority for Advance Rulings (Central Excise, Customs & Service Tax) to give binding rulings, in advance, on Central Excise, Customs and Service Tax matters pertaining to an investment venture in India is one such measure. The legal provisions of Advance Rulings were introduced through the Finance Acts of 1998, 1999 and 2003.

Taking into account the detailed submissions of the applicant, including the likely usage of the article under consideration, absence of specific heading/ sub-heading for HDPE woven fabric in Chapter 39, positive mention of the dust sheet in Explanatory Note to Heading 3926, I find that HDPE woven fabrics (uncoated/one-side coated/double-side coated) are most appropriately covered under residual heading 3926 and further the residual sub-heading 3926 9099 of the Customs Tariff Act ,1975.
